I looked at bad wheels too but them billets specialties on their site say $600ea retail. I kinda dont see too many other nice billets for that cheap, but prove me wrong:)
I talked to a buddy who says he has a hookup with billet specialties and supposedly he can get that street series in 20's for $1100/set but we'll see how that goes